Beirut, May 17 (QNA) – The Israeli occupation army continued its attacks on southern Lebanon in violation of the truce that began on April 16 for a period of ten days, was extended on April 24 for three weeks and was again extended last Friday for an additional 45 days.
The Lebanese National News Agency (NNA) reported that an Israeli drone carried out an airstrike on the town of Jibchit in the Nabatieh district in southern Lebanon.
Israeli warplanes also launched a strike targeting the town of Tayr Debba in the Tyre district, while the town of Sohmor in the Western Bekaa in eastern Lebanon was subjected to two airstrikes. (QNA)
